In this modern adaptation of the classic French novel "Story of O" by Pauline Réage, Luvana tackled the enigmatic title role, a character known simply as . The film explores the underground world of submission and domination, following O as she "discovers the pleasure and satisfaction from surrendering completely to the desires of others" . The film's central philosophical question is: can a woman find true power in absolute submission?
